The world leading eyewear provider is still experiencing tough market conditions. The first signs of recovery reported by luxury goods operators were missed by Luxottica. Sales were up by 1.9% at CER in Q1 (+5.2% reported) to €2,384m. Comparable store sales were down. Revenue was depressed in the wholesale channel which posted flat sales at CER (+2.5% reported) to €958m. Retail sales grew by a single digit 3.3% at CER to €1,426m (+7.1% reported).
